Restroom floor covering
Try to stay clear of the urge to put carpetings on the bathroom flooring, according to the survey it is not as well favoured. The study revealed that the preferred floor covering was tiles, with 75 percent claiming they "liked" a tiled restroom floor. Popular plastic floor covering has not yet lost its area in the shower room, with more than 61 percent stating they didn't have any kind of solid sort or dislikes in the direction of it.
When choosing your bathroom floor covering, ceramic tiles is the favoured alternative, however if the budget plan is tight, after that vinyl floor covering will not let you down.
Apart from the floor covering, make certain your windows look appealing. When it pertains to dressing your washroom windows, stay away from those restroom webs and textile curtains. The survey revealed that 94 percent stated they favoured blinds in the washroom to curtains.
Shower power
When preparing the layout of your bathroom, among the most crucial elements to take into consideration is positioning a shower. Some washrooms do not have ample room to consist of a shower work area, so analyze your alternatives. Take into consideration installing a shower over the bathroom if space is restricted.
The survey revealed that 94 percent of its participants thought that a shower in a shower room was very crucial, and also 81 percent stated they preferred a different shower room in a big shower room. Almost 65 percent claimed their suitable would certainly be a power shower, while 27 percent liked mixer showers, as well as only 12 percent selected electric showers.
If you have actually selected a shower over the bathroom, then think about positioning a fixed glass display instead of a shower drape. It may set you back a few additional pounds, but over half of the study's contributors liked a set glass screen to a shower curtain.
Picking your bath tub
In contrast to usual belief, adding a whirlpool bath to boost residential property worth does not always do the trick. So if you're considering offering your building, attempt to prevent acquiring a whirlpool bath in the hopes of getting extra profit.
The study disclosed that near to 53 per cent of its individuals were not phased by them, while just a small 38 per cent of individuals "enjoyed" them. Surprisingly, 62 per cent stated they had "no strong sight" towards edge bathrooms either, which indicates the traditional rectangle-shaped bathrooms still hold influence versus their improved counter parts.
Hello there simpleness
From as far back as the 1960s much emphasis was put on bold colour in the washroom. Formed wall surface ceramic tiles of nautical creatures and also excessive colours were the fad, together with plastic. Plastic washroom design was the fad, from bold orange, olive eco-friendly, mustard yellow and also chocolate brown coloured toothbrush, soap and also towel owners, to thick patterned plastic shower curtains that shrieked colours of the boldest nature.
As the moments moved on, the 1970s and early 1980s ended up being a duration when gold washroom repairings as well as providing, such as taps, towel rails as well as toilet roll holders, were thought about very stylish. These ostentatious gold trimmed features were all the rage, and bathroom decor was 'loud'. Included in this were those when wonderful washroom suites in colours avocado, coral pink, and also delicious chocolate brown. Shower room colour has transformed considerably over the past years, and also tones have actually become extra neutral, occasionally with a hint of colour that adds a complementary vigour to the total plan.
Of the many numerous individuals that took part in Plumbworld's recent bathroom study, an overwhelming 82 per cent claimed they "hated" the as soon as glorified avocado and coral reefs pink shower room collections, colours remnant of 1970s and also 1980s, which are usually qualified as being dark as well as boring.
According to the survey, chrome shower room taps were much preferred to gold.
So, when designing and decorating your washroom keep those dark colours away, take into consideration white suites, as well as go with chrome repairings as well as furnishings instead of flashy gold.

The 5 Benefits Of Renovating Your Bathroom
Looking for simple renovations that will give your home a face lift? Start with your bathroom, especially if you have pink tile and a baby blue toilet. Outdated bathrooms can stop potential buyers in their tracks. Even if you're not looking to sell, it's nice to feel like you're living in the current decade. Besides increasing the value of your home, the bathroom can be a place to get creative and have some fun. Here are five major benefits a bathroom re-do can offer:
Increase your home's value
According to HGTV.com, a minor bathroom remodel gives you a 102% return at resale. A minor remodel encompasses replacing the tub, tile surround, floor, toilet, sink, vanity, and fixtures, then perhaps finishing off the project with a fresh coat of paint on the walls. As you renovate, keep in mind the color and decorating trends of today and if those trends will have lasting value in the future.
Save money now
Replacing leaky faucets, adding aerators, and installing an on-demand water heater and a water-efficient toilet will save you big bucks on utility costs.
Become a more peaceful oasis
Performing your daily ablutions in a messy, unattractive space with old, substandard fixtures can be a source of stress. With a renovation, you can unwind in a claw-foot tub and dry off afterwards with heated towels. You can choose colors and textures that will help you relax and soothe stress away, taking you to your happy place.
Reduce clutter
Poorly designed bathrooms invite clutter, so when you renovate you can increase storage capacity with the smart designs available in today's cabinetry. You can finally find discreet homes for your towels, cleaners, toiletries, and medicines.
Become more eco-friendly
You can reclaim and repurpose an older porcelain sink, saving it from a landfill. Or you can buy new fixtures and materials from companies developing products that are energy-efficient, low-tox, biodegradable, and/or recyclable.
